Journey's Story
Meet Journey who, a testament to her name, has had a tremendous journey. She is around 2 years old and was surrendered to us after her previous owners passed away. Journey has seemed like a shy girl but doesn't particularly mind being pet or having love. She has been around people of all ages as well as both cats and dogs, which she both did well with. A few of her favorite sleeping spots include by your feet and in high spots close to the ceiling. Once Journey warms up, she's a lap cat and she loves to climb so keep scratching posts close by!
